Warning Signs You Need Office Building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Don’t wait – address the issue quickly and efficiently with our expert office building water damage restoration services.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and potential m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ell – address it quickly with our expert water damage restoration services.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ue – don’t ignore them. Our team will work to identify the source of the problem and provide a customized plan for restoration.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den moisture and potential safety hazards. Don’t ignore the issue – address it quickly with our expert water damage restoration services.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den moisture and potential mold growth. Don’t ignore the issue – address it quickly with our expert water damage restoration services.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in Sunizona, AZ

The cost of office building water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sunizona, AZ. These are estimates, not guarantees,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s.
Cleaning and sanitizing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ed, and labor costs.
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or costs.
Moisture detection and remov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s.
Dehumidification and dr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s.
Disinfecting and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ed, and labor costs.
